TBMs demand the right trailer from the start. Depending on weight, height, and how the machine is configured, we may assign RGNs, lowboys, step decks, double drops, or multi-axle trailers. Heavy Haulers choose those setups to keep deck height down, spread axle weight, and maintain control through turns, ramps, and bridge approaches. For segmented TBM parts, flatbed trucking companies may be able to handle smaller pieces, but the main body, cutterhead, or support modules often call for heavier gear. Heavy Haulers also account for center of gravity, tie-down points, and how the load sits on the trailer once it leaves the port area. In some cases, a multi-axle configuration is the only practical option for weight distribution and axle compliance. Oregon oversize moves require careful permit work, and TBMs often trigger more than one layer of review. Heavy Haulers plan for state permits, route surveys, height checks, weight limits, and bridge clearances before the truck ever rolls. Around Portland, that means looking closely at I-5, I-84, I-205, US-26, and key industrial connectors that can handle over-dimensional hauling. Heavy Haulers also watch interchange geometry, turning radius, shoulder width, and utility conflicts, because a machine this size cannot be moved on guesswork. Escort needs depend on width, length, and route conditions, and some moves may require pilot cars or additional traffic control. Oregon agencies may also set time-of-day restrictions or approved corridors, especially when the load approaches structure limits.
